当前位置: 首页 > 数据中台  > 数据可视化平台

大数据可视化平台与机器人技术的融合应用

本文探讨了大数据可视化平台与机器人技术的结合,通过实际代码展示其在数据采集与展示中的应用。

随着信息技术的快速发展,大数据和人工智能技术逐渐成为推动社会进步的重要力量。其中,数据可视化平台为数据的分析与展示提供了直观、高效的手段,而机器人技术则在自动化任务执行方面展现出巨大潜力。两者的结合,为智能系统的设计与实现提供了新的方向。

 

在实际应用中,机器人可以作为数据采集的终端设备,通过传感器获取环境数据,并将这些数据传输至大数据可视化平台进行处理与展示。例如,使用Python语言结合ROS(Robot Operating System)框架,可以构建一个简单的机器人数据采集系统。以下是一个基础示例代码:

 

大数据

    import rospy
    from std_msgs.msg import String

    def talker():
        pub = rospy.Publisher('chatter', String, queue_size=10)
        rospy.init_node('talker', anonymous=True)
        rate = rospy.Rate(10) # 10hz
        while not rospy.is_shutdown():
            hello_str = "hello world %s" % rospy.get_time()
            rospy.loginfo(hello_str)
            pub.publish(hello_str)
            rate.sleep()

    if __name__ == '__main__':
        try:
            talker()
        except rospy.ROSInterruptException:
            pass
    

 

上述代码展示了如何在ROS中发布一个话题,该话题可用于机器人与可视化平台之间的数据通信。大数据可视化平台可利用如Grafana或Echarts等工具,将接收到的数据以图表形式展示,便于用户理解与决策。

 

综上所述,大数据可视化平台与机器人技术的融合,不仅提升了数据处理的效率,也为智能化系统的开发提供了强大的技术支持。

*以上内容来源于互联网,如不慎侵权,联系必删!

相关资讯

    暂无相关的数据...